
EXCEL怎么操作保留位数
使用“单元格格式”功能、应用“ROUND函数”、通过“TEXT函数”格式化、使用“条件格式”、利用“自定义数值格式”。其中,使用“单元格格式”功能是最简单且常用的方法,通过设置单元格的数字格式,可以轻松地控制数字显示的位数。
在Excel中操作保留位数是一个非常实用的技能,特别是在处理财务数据、统计数据或需要进行准确数据展示时。通过调整数字的显示格式,可以确保数据的整洁和专业性。具体操作步骤如下:首先选择需要格式化的单元格,然后右键选择“设置单元格格式”,在“数字”选项卡中选择“数值”,接着设定小数位数即可。这样可以确保数据在视觉上保持一致,便于阅读和分析。
一、使用“单元格格式”功能
使用“单元格格式”功能是Excel中最直观和简单的方法之一。这种方法主要用于控制数字的显示格式,而不会改变实际存储的值。
1.1 操作步骤
- 选择需要格式化的单元格或区域:首先,用鼠标选中需要调整显示格式的单元格或区域。
- 右键单击并选择“设置单元格格式”:在弹出的菜单中选择“设置单元格格式”。
- 在“数字”选项卡中选择“数值”:进入“数值”选项后,可以看到“小数位数”的选项。
- 设定小数位数:根据需要设定小数位数,点击“确定”完成操作。
通过这些步骤,可以轻松地调整数据的显示格式,使得数据在视觉上更为整齐和专业。
1.2 示例
假设你有一组数据需要保留两位小数:
3.14159
2.71828
1.61803
通过上述步骤,将这些数值设置为保留两位小数后的结果为:
3.14
2.72
1.62
二、应用“ROUND函数”
“ROUND函数”是Excel中用于数值四舍五入的函数,通过它可以精确地控制保留的位数。
2.1 基本语法
ROUND(number, num_digits)
number:需要四舍五入的数字。num_digits:指定保留的小数位数。
2.2 操作步骤
- 选择一个空白单元格输入公式:在需要显示结果的单元格中输入
=ROUND(目标单元格, 位数)。 - 按Enter键确认:按Enter键确认后,单元格将显示四舍五入后的结果。
2.3 示例
假设你有一个数值3.14159,需要保留两位小数:
=ROUND(3.14159, 2)
结果为:
3.14
三、通过“TEXT函数”格式化
使用“TEXT函数”可以将数字转换为文本格式,同时控制显示的位数。
3.1 基本语法
TEXT(value, format_text)
value:需要格式化的数字。format_text:指定的格式。
3.2 操作步骤
- 选择一个空白单元格输入公式:在需要显示结果的单元格中输入
=TEXT(目标单元格, "格式")。 - 按Enter键确认:按Enter键确认后,单元格将显示格式化后的结果。
3.3 示例
假设你有一个数值3.14159,需要保留两位小数:
=TEXT(3.14159, "0.00")
结果为:
3.14
四、使用“条件格式”
“条件格式”可以根据条件自动应用格式,但是它通常用于视觉效果而不是数值计算。然而,通过结合条件格式和其他函数,可以实现保留位数的效果。
4.1 操作步骤
- 选择需要应用条件格式的单元格或区域:用鼠标选中需要应用条件格式的单元格。
- 点击“条件格式”并选择“新建规则”:在菜单中选择“新建规则”。
- 选择“使用公式确定要设置格式的单元格”:输入公式。
- 设置格式:根据需要设置格式。
4.2 示例
假设你有一组数据,需要保留两位小数,并且当数值大于3时显示红色:
- 选择数据区域。
- 点击“条件格式” -> “新建规则”。
- 选择“使用公式确定要设置格式的单元格”,输入公式
=AND(A1>3, ROUND(A1, 2))。 - 设置格式为红色。
五、利用“自定义数值格式”
“自定义数值格式”可以通过设置特定的格式代码来控制数字的显示形式。
5.1 操作步骤
- 选择需要格式化的单元格或区域:用鼠标选中需要自定义格式的单元格。
- 右键单击并选择“设置单元格格式”:在弹出的菜单中选择“设置单元格格式”。
- 选择“自定义”:在“数字”选项卡中选择“自定义”。
- 输入格式代码:根据需要输入格式代码,例如保留两位小数的代码为
0.00。
5.2 示例
假设你有一组数据需要保留两位小数:
3.14159
2.71828
1.61803
通过上述步骤,将这些数值设置为保留两位小数后的结果为:
3.14
2.72
1.62
六、使用“公式”进行高级处理
在某些复杂情况下,可能需要使用更高级的公式和函数来处理数据。例如,使用ROUNDUP和ROUNDDOWN函数来分别实现向上和向下取整。
6.1 基本语法
ROUNDUP(number, num_digits):向上取整。ROUNDDOWN(number, num_digits):向下取整。
6.2 示例
假设你有一个数值3.14159,需要向上取整到两位小数:
=ROUNDUP(3.14159, 2)
结果为:
3.15
类似地,使用ROUNDDOWN函数可以向下取整:
=ROUNDDOWN(3.14159, 2)
结果为:
3.14
七、在不同场景中的应用
在不同的工作场景中,保留位数的操作可能略有不同。以下是几个常见的应用场景:
7.1 财务数据处理
在财务数据处理中,通常需要保留两位小数以确保金额的准确性。使用上述方法可以确保数据的专业和准确。
7.2 科学计算
在科学计算中,精度通常非常重要。通过使用ROUND、ROUNDUP、ROUNDDOWN等函数,可以确保计算结果的精度。
7.3 数据展示
在数据展示中,控制数字的位数可以使报告更为简洁和易读。通过设置单元格格式或使用TEXT函数,可以轻松实现这一点。
八、自动化处理
通过VBA(Visual Basic for Applications),可以实现自动化处理保留位数的操作,特别是在需要批量处理数据时。
8.1 VBA代码示例
以下是一个简单的VBA代码示例,用于将选定区域内的数字保留两位小数:
Sub 保留两位小数()
Dim cell As Range
For Each cell In Selection
If IsNumeric(cell.Value) Then
cell.Value = Round(cell.Value, 2)
End If
Next cell
End Sub
8.2 操作步骤
- 打开VBA编辑器:按Alt + F11打开VBA编辑器。
- 插入新模块:在“插入”菜单中选择“模块”。
- 粘贴代码:将上述代码粘贴到模块中。
- 运行代码:关闭VBA编辑器,回到Excel,选择需要处理的区域,然后按Alt + F8运行宏。
九、总结
在Excel中操作保留位数是一个非常实用的技能,通过使用“单元格格式”功能、应用“ROUND函数”、通过“TEXT函数”格式化、使用“条件格式”、利用“自定义数值格式”等方法,可以轻松实现这一目标。无论是在财务数据处理、科学计算还是数据展示中,这些方法都能帮助我们确保数据的准确性和专业性。通过结合这些方法,可以根据具体需求灵活处理数据,提升工作效率。
相关问答FAQs:
1. 保留位数的操作在Excel中如何进行?
- 在Excel中,您可以使用“格式单元格”选项来操作保留位数。首先,选中您想要格式化的单元格或单元格范围,然后右键单击并选择“格式单元格”选项。
- 在弹出的对话框中,选择“数字”选项卡,并选择您想要的数字格式。您可以在“小数位数”字段中指定要保留的小数位数。
- 如果您想要固定位数,而不是保留小数位数,您可以在“数字”选项卡中选择“文本”格式,然后手动输入要显示的位数。
2. 如何在Excel中设置特定单元格的保留位数?
- 如果您只想为特定的单元格设置保留位数,而不是整个列或工作表,可以在单元格中直接应用格式。
- 首先,选中要设置格式的单元格,然后在“开始”选项卡的“数字”组中,选择“小数位数”按钮,并选择您想要的位数。
- 您还可以使用快捷键Ctrl+Shift+1来应用默认的数字格式,它会自动保留位数。
3. 如何在Excel公式中保留特定位数的小数?
- 如果您需要在Excel公式中保留特定位数的小数,可以使用内置的函数来实现。例如,要保留两位小数,您可以在公式中使用以下函数:ROUND(number,2)。
- 这将对指定的数值进行四舍五入,并保留两位小数。您可以根据需要更改数字和位数。
- 如果您想要直接截断小数位而不是四舍五入,可以使用函数:TRUNC(number,2)。这将截断指定数值的小数位,并保留两位小数。
注意:以上方法适用于Excel的最新版本。如果您使用的是旧版本的Excel,请参考该版本的帮助文档或在线资源。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4660796